Sport in the park: free summer offer for all Paderborn!
On Monday, May 12th, the popular series of events “Sport im Park” starts in Paderborn. This initiative, which is organized by the Kreissportbund Paderborn (KSB) together with the sports service of the city of Paderborn, has the goal of motivating the Paderborn citizens to make more exercise and health promotion. The program is free of charge, takes place outdoors and does not require prior registration. An advantage that attracts many sports enthusiasts.
Last year, the program counted over 3,000 participants, which underlines the great encouragement and interest in movement offers. The courses offered are aimed at all fitness levels and include a wide range of formats. These include Vinyasa Yoga, Zumba, the "Pader-Fit" workout as well as running and walking groups. New in this year's offer are the courses in Wewer as well as the format "Body Movement" and "SCP07 moved".
diverse offers for every taste
A particularly remarkable aspect of the program is that the courses take place under the instructions of experienced trainers from local sports clubs. The training locations include the Paderwiesen and the Wilhelmsberg in Neuhaus Castle. The participants are also asked to bring comfortable clothing, a towel or mat as well as a drink. The courses basically take place in any weather, unless there is heavy rain, thunderstorms or hail.
- Morgen Yoga: Vinyasa Yoga focuses on the harmony of breath and movement and is suitable for all levels of experience.
- Qigong: This old Chinese form promotes health and mindfulness through breathing exercises.
- Zumba: An attractive mix of dance and fitness that offers a lot of fun and effective training.
- Paderfit Workout: An outdoor training on evenings that combine strength and endurance elements.
- running & walking: This offer is aimed at everyone who likes to move in the fresh air.
- body movement: targeted exercises to improve strength and coordination.
- SCP07 moves: football fans can move without pressure to perform and experience community.
The central range of offer on the pader meadows was slightly laid to offer the participants more space and a better atmosphere.
